
Kubesprayusa grupos com nomes definidos no inventário Ansible para especificar funções de diferentes nós, e esses nós se conectarão entre si. Mas agora preciso de dois clusters separados (porque cada um residirá em sub-redes diferentes com políticas de segurança diferentes). Existe uma maneira de manter um inventário com definições comuns ou preciso dividir o inventário pelos dois clusters?
Responder1
Eu não recomendo fortemente que você complique as coisas com o kubespray e meu conselho é sempre usar arquivos de inventário separados para clusters diferentes. Usar 1 arquivo de inventário pode (e muito provavelmente) levar a erros adicionais e desperdiçar seu tempo tentando resolvê-los, em vez de simplesmente girar 2 clusters de 2 arquivos e usá-los. Aliás, nunca vi tal implementação. Certamente, você pode fazer isso sozinho, mas você realmente precisa disso?
Eu atualizaria esta resposta caso encontrasse uma solução concreta para você. Deixando-o como wiki da comunidade